  • Join me in this week's episode as we hike from White's Pass to Steven's Pass. In this section, there's a norovirus outbreak, amazing views, a trip to the tattoo shop, and a very unwell me trying to keep up with the miles when I'm feeling terrible. This section is challenging but it sure is beautiful.
